Village Shopping Centre

Index Village Shopping Centre

The Village Shopping Centre (commonly referred to as The Village)http://www.cbc.ca/news/canada/newfoundland-labrador/if-shopping-malls-are-dying-why-can-t-i-get-a-parking-space-1.1284117 is a shopping centre in St. John's,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ada. [1]
